Lets compare vitamin content per 1 kilogram of Dry Roasted Pistachio Nuts with Salt vs Dried Beechnuts:
- 1 kilogram of Dry Roasted Pistachio Nuts with Salt has 2.3 times more Vitamin B1, 1.6 times more Vitamin B3 and 1.6 times more Vitamin B6 than Dried Beechnuts.
- While 1 kg of Dried Beechnuts contains 1.6 times more Vitamin B2, 1.8 times more Vitamin B5, 2.2 times more Vitamin B9 and 5.2 times more Vitamin C than Dry Roasted Pistachio Nuts with Salt.
- Both Dry Roasted Pistachio Nuts with Salt as well as Dried Beechnuts have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A and Vitamin B12 in one kilogram.
Comparing minerals per 1 kilogram for Dry Roasted Pistachio Nuts with Salt vs Dried Beechnuts:
- 1 kilogram of Dry Roasted Pistachio Nuts with Salt has 107 times more Calcium, 1.9 times more Copper, 1.6 times more Iron, more Magnesium, more Phosphorus, 11.3 times more Sodium and 6.5 times more Zinc than Dried Beechnuts.
- Both Dry Roasted Pistachio Nuts with Salt and Dried Beechnuts contain similar levels of Manganese and Potassium per one kilogram.
- 1 kilogram of Dried Beechnuts lack sufficient amounts of Calcium, Magnesium and Phosphorus
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 1 kilogram:
- 1 kilogram of Dry Roasted Pistachio Nuts with Salt has 3.4 times more Protein than Dried Beechnuts.
- While 1 kg of Dried Beechnuts contains 8 times more Omega 3 and 1.4 times more Omega 6 than Dry Roasted Pistachio Nuts with Salt.
- Both Dry Roasted Pistachio Nuts with Salt and Dried Beechnuts offer comparable quantities of Energy, Fat, Saturated Fat and Carbohydrate per one kilogram.
